FACILITIES TICKET — Badge System Migration, Halloway Campus

Priority: High

We are migrating from the legacy Doorward readers to the new Keystile panels this weekend. During the cutover, reception staff should expect some staff badges to fail at the main entrance. Please log every failed read in the migration sheet and reassure staff that re-enrolment is automatic by Monday. Do not issue temporary badges without a manager's sign-off. Until the Keystile panels go live, the interim door code is below.

turnstile pass: bdg-AK-2

- Pool car keys: night shift collects from the key cabinet outside the Drayvern Logistics dispatch office, Level 1. Check the log sheet before taking any fob. Sign out with time and vehicle number; sign back in on return. Never leave the cabinet unlocked or keys on the desk. If a key is missing, flag it to the duty supervisor immediately — do not wait for day shift. Report any cabinet fault to facilities overnight line. The cabinet opens with the code below.

staff pass of kawip-hawef = bdg-QLP-2

Subject: DR Drill — Meridix Calendar Sync

Hello, and welcome to the contract team. Next Tuesday we will rehearse recovering the Meridix sync service from the conflict that duplicated events across the Oakhaven and Ferndale tenants. Please read the runbook beforehand and attend the dry run at 10:00.

During the drill, the restore console will request the recovery passphrase listed below.

vault phrase of fahog-yajof = istael-zorwyn